Required Qualifications

  • Current ARRT RT(R) credential — required upon submission
  • Current ARRT (CT) credential — required upon submission
  • Current unencumbered Oregon license in Radiologic Technology
  • Healthcare Provider BLS certification

About Lebanon, OR

As a Travel CT Technologist in Lebanon, OR here's what you should know:
Cost of Living
  • The cost of living in Lebanon, OR is slightly lower than the national average, making it an affordable place to live.
  • Wages generally match up with the lower cost of living, providing good value for residents.
Weather
  • Lebanon experiences a mild climate with average summer highs around 80°F and winter lows around 33°F, offering a comfortable range of temperatures throughout the year.
Furnished Housing
  • Short-term rentals and furnished housing options are available in Lebanon, making it relatively easy for travel nurses to find suitable accommodations.
Transportation
  • Lebanon is car-friendly with easy access to major highways.
  • Public transportation options are limited, so having a car is essential for getting around the area.
Demographics
  • The population of Lebanon, OR is diverse, with a mix of age ranges.
  • Common health issues may include allergies and respiratory conditions due to the proximity to forests and agricultural areas.
  • There is a growing population of travel nurses in the area.
Things to Do
  • Lebanon offers a variety of restaurants, including local eateries and popular chains.
  • The city has a vibrant arts community with galleries and live music venues.
  • Outdoor enthusiasts can enjoy hiking, fishing, and camping in the nearby natural areas.
